Cutting methodWhen taking cuttings of Chlorophytum comosum, you can choose branches from plants that are growing more robustly and cut them off for cuttings. When taking cuttings, the soil requirements are not high. Generally, a mixed soil is chosen, which is a mixture of peat soil, perlite, pebbles, etc. Some organic fertilizer can also be added. After processing the branches, you can carry out cuttings. After cuttings, place them in a cool place and pay attention to moisturizing. After it grows new shoots, you can move it to a place with sufficient light. IllustrationCut healthy branches, about 10 cm long. Prepare the potting soil, plant the branches for cuttings, and make sure to water them thoroughly. After cuttings, place them in a ventilated and cool place and spray water frequently. They will generally take root in 2 weeks. |
